WebLiterally, relate would be translated in french as: "Rapporter" or "Référer", thus you could say something like: "Je peux m'y référer." Which would mean that you could remember this kind of experience happened to you too. However, these kind of phrases are hardly used in french. As others already said, the closest things you could say would ... WebScore: 4.4/5 (8 votes) . The verb relate means "to make a connection."If you can relate to someone's story, something like that has happened to you. Relate also means "to give an account of something verbally," like relating details of your trip to Sweden. Similarly, how we relate is learned from … WebNov 11, 2024 · For situation B this is probably better that the other two. "I can relate" sounds odd to me without adding "to that". But "I know the feeling" is fairly neutral, and therefore I too prefer it for situation A. Edited to add: "I can relate to that" doesn't necessarily mean that the speaker has actually had a similar experience.
